Helen L. Villanueva, loving wife and lovable aunt, died Sunday, November 16, 2014, in La Habra, CA.
She was born November 14, 1921, in Douglas, AZ, to James and Ana Maria Liakopulos.
She moved to Tucson, AZ, and married the love of her life, Liberto Villanueva.
She worked for the US Air Force and later the Red Cross.
With no children, she spoiled her sister's kids like a second mother. An artist, her paintings sold at local fairs. She found humor in everything and was a joy to be with.
When Bert died, she moved to CA, close to family. She will be greatly missed by her nieces, nephews, and their children.
